Rachel Edwards

Rachel Edwards is a MS Coastal and Marine System Science student at Texas A&M University- Corpus Christi and a graduate research assistant at Harte Research Institute’s Coastal and Marine Geospatial Lab. She graduated with a BA in 2014 from the University of North Carolina with highest honors in Geography with a concentration in GIS and a minor in Marine Science. Her undergraduate research project used GIS to examine the spatial distribution of sea sponges in Florida Bay. Rachel’s thesis addresses sea level rise in Galveston Bay, TX and how public policies may affect its long-term impacts. Outside interests include training and competing in the equestrian sport dressage and volunteering with Big Brothers Big Sisters and the Texas Marine Mammal Stranding Network.
